This paper is concerned with stability analysis for singular systems with interval time-varying delay. By constructing a novel Lyapunov functional combined with reciprocally convex approach and linear matrix inequality (LMI) technique, improved delay-dependent stability criteria for the considered systems to be regular, impulse free, and stable are established. The developed results have advantages over some previous ones as they involve fewer decision variables yet less conservatism. Numerical examples are provided to dem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ed stability results.

In this paper, we consider the problem of robust delay-dependent stability for a class of linear uncertain systems with interval time-varying delay. By using the directly Lyapunov-Krasovskii (L-K) functional method, integral inequality approach and the free weighting matrix technique, new less conservative stability criteria for the system is formulated in terms of linear matrix inequalities .Numerical examples are given to show the effectiveness of the proposed approach.

This paper is concerned with delay-dependent stability for systems with interval time varying delay. By defining a new Lyapunov functional which contains a triple-integral term with the idea of decomposing the delay interval of time-varying delay, an improved criterion of asymptotic stability is derived in term of linear matrix inequalities. The criterion proves to be less conservative with fewer matrix variables than some previous ones. Finally, a numerical example is given to show the effectiveness of the proposed method.

This paper addresses the delay-dependent stability for systems with time-varying delay. First, by taking multi-integral terms into consideration, new Lyapunov-Krasovskii functional is defined. Second, in order to reduce the computational complexity of the main results, reciprocally convex approach and some special transformations are introduced, and new delay-dependent stability criteria are proposed, which are less conservative and have less decision variables than some previous results. Finally, two well-known examples are given to illustrate the correctness and advantage of our theoretical results.

This paper investigates delay-dependent stability problem for singular systems with interval time-varying delay. An appropriate Lyapunov-Krasovskii functional is constructed by decomposing the delay interval into multiple equidistant subintervals, where both the information of every subinterval and time-varying delay have been taken into account. Employing the Lyapunov-Krasovskii functional, improved delay-dependent stability criteria for the considered systems to be regular, impulse-free, and stable are established. Finally, two numerical examples are presented to show the effectiveness and less conservativeness of the proposed method.
